Suwannee Blue-Eyed Grass
Sisyrinchium sp. ‘Suwannee’
$12.00
Found on the banks of the Suwannee River, this selection produces clouds of 3/4” sky-blue flowers in April. Sisyrinchiums are not actually grasses, they’re part of the iris family. Suwannee has a compact growth habit and the dense, evergreen foliage grows to 8”. Fast-multiplying.
